1 Chronicles 2:25

Made Simple — Modern English Translation

Translated by Verse Made Simple Editorial
KJV ORIGINAL
And the sons of Jerahmeel the firstborn of Hezron were, Ram the firstborn, and Bunah, and Oren, and Ozem, and Ahijah.
Close to the original. Clear modern English.
✦ MADE SIMPLE

The sons of Jerahmeel (who was Hezron's firstborn son) were Ram (his firstborn), Bunah, Oren, Ozem, and Ahijah.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

This verse lists the five sons of Jerahmeel, showing how God's people's family lines continued through generations.

📚 Historical Context

In the book of 1 Chronicles, the author is compiling detailed genealogies of the Israelite tribes to trace God's ongoing plan through families and highlight key figures in Israel's history. Jerahmeel was the firstborn son of Hezron, a descendant of Judah, and this verse lists his sons as part of the broader lineage from Abraham to David, emphasizing the importance of tribal heritage. These records served practical purposes in ancient Israel, such as determining inheritance, land ownership, and religious leadership.
